This study was conducted by DVRPC’s Office of Smart Growth to document the existing conditions of proposed station areas for the Camden County portion of the Glassboro-Camden Line. The Glassboro-Camden Line is an 18-mile transit route proposed to link Camden and Gloucester counties to the existing Port Authority Transit Corporation (PATCO) high speed line running between Philadelphia and Camden County,……

This report documents problems associated with landside access to two facilities proposed for the former Philadelphia Naval Base (currently being redeveloped and marketed under the name "Philadelphia Naval Business Center").
The report also designates the most appropriate highway routes between the proposed FastShip and CSXI intermodal facilities and the surrounding interstate highways.
